U.S. WOOL YIELD

LARGER CROP PREDICTED

CHICAGO, April IS

Officials of the Federal Farm Board announce that they will handle a larger portion of the wool yield than in 1930, and that the yield itself will be larger. Wool is the one bright spot in the Farm Board's operations. The board supplied £2.000.000 to assist the orderly marketing of 119,000,0001b of wool last year.
